'https://gestorvr.qualitat.cl/api/auth/token', CURLOPT_RETURNTRANSFER => true, CURLOPT_ENCODING => '', CURLOPT_MAXREDIRS => 10, CURLOPT_TIMEOUT => 0, CURLOPT_FOLLOWLOCATION => true, CURLOPT_HTTP_VERSION => CURL_HTTP_VERSION_1_1, CURLOPT_CUSTOMREQUEST => 'POST', CURLOPT_POSTFIELDS =>'{ "username":"araucocurricular", "password":"arauco@2021", "grant_type":"password", "client_id":"client_araucocurricular", "client_secret":"Wah4FAbLr6q4HZuB" }', CURLOPT_HTTPHEADER => array( 'Content-Type: application/json', 'Cookie: PHPSESSID=ik02k081o6b8n31n5a4p76b5ba' ), )); $response = curl_exec($curl); $json=json_decode($response); $mData=$json->token;//obtengo el token para conexion //echo $mData; curl_close($curl); $curl = curl_init(); $pagina=1; $verdadero=false; while ($pagina<=500) { curl_setopt_array($curl, array( CURLOPT_URL => 'https://gestorvr.qualitat.cl/api/v1/araucocurricular?page='.$pagina, CURLOPT_RETURNTRANSFER => true, CURLOPT_ENCODING => '', CURLOPT_MAXREDIRS => 10, CURLOPT_TIMEOUT => 0, CURLOPT_FOLLOWLOCATION => true, CURLOPT_HTTP_VERSION => CURL_HTTP_VERSION_1_1, CURLOPT_CUSTOMREQUEST => 'GET', CURLOPT_HTTPHEADER => array( 'Authorization: Bearer '.$mData ), )); $response = curl_exec($curl); $json=json_decode($response, true); if ($json==$guarda) { $verdadero=true; $pagina=501; } else { $guarda=$json; } if ($verdadero == false) { foreach ($json as $record) { $id = $record['data']['trab_rut']; $conduc = $record['data']['con_nota']; $dec = $record['data']['dec_nota']; $id1 = $record['id']; $cadena=str_replace(' ', '', $id); // echo "'".$id1."' = '".$cadena."'
"; // echo "'".$conduc."'
"; // echo "'".$dec."'
"; $sql4="UPDATE trabajador_prueba2 SET ev_conducta='".$conduc."',ev_percepcion='".$dec."' WHERE rut='".$id."' and cod_empresa=7"; $result4= mysql_query($sql4, $link); } } $pagina=$pagina+1; } curl_close($curl); $total=3; return($total); } ?>